Rio de Janeiro, Brazil – The Fluminense Board of Directors addressed speculation regarding potential Arab investment in the club’s football corporation (SAF) during a meeting with journalists Tuesday, April 16, 2025.

Arab Fund Interest Unconfirmed
While confirming initial inquiries from an Arab fund, the board refuted reports that a formal proposal was rejected outright. According to the club, an intermediary made the initial contact, and the inquiry was subsequently passed to BTG Pactual for evaluation.
Following the submission of documents, the intermediary sought feedback from the bank.Though, Fluminense officials stated that no further communication has been received from the Arab investors as then.
Focus on Alternative Investment Model
Instead of seeking external investment, Fluminense is exploring an alternative model centered on establishing an investment fund comprised of investors with ties to the club.
Club leadership believes this approach would prioritize sporting performance alongside financial returns, distinguishing it from models like Red Bull Bragantino, where profit motives are perceived to take precedence.
The club continues to explore options for the SAF project.
